COM:ALIBABAGROUP
Alibaba Group
- Stock
Last Close
85.58
22/11 21:00
Market Cap
171.94B
Beta: -
Volume Today
66.27K
Avg: -
Preview
Full access to financials is available to subscribers only. Please support our work and get full access to all features. You can cancel anytime. If you'd like a demo, free trial or have any questions, please checkout the help page
Mar '14 | Mar '15 | Mar '16 | Mar '17 | Mar '18 | Mar '19 | Mar '20 | Mar '21 | Mar '22 | Mar '23 | Mar '24 | ||
---|---|---|---|---|---|---|---|---|---|---|---|---|
average inventory | 5.49B - | 4.31B 21.60% | -6.69B 255.40% | -4.18B 37.57% | 5.93B 241.95% | 6.53B 10.18% | 11.70B 79.00% | 21.36B 82.61% | 28.97B 35.65% | 29.32B 1.19% | 14.27B 51.31% | |
average payables | 1.47B - | 10.94B 646.50% | 23.58B 115.58% | 23.75B 0.70% | 50.66B 113.33% | 99.44B 96.27% | 139.62B 40.41% | 211.23B 51.29% | 266.19B 26.02% | 273.70B 2.82% | 286.92B 4.83% | |
average receivables | 10.36B - | 8.39B 19.07% | 8.93B 6.49% | 19.59B 119.39% | 32.70B 66.85% | 50.91B 55.71% | 71.41B 40.27% | 104.47B 46.29% | 135.35B 29.56% | 112.32B 17.02% | 39.32B 64.99% | |
book value per share | 18.22 - | 62.23 241.62% | 88.28 41.85% | 111.83 26.68% | 143.28 28.12% | 190.80 33.16% | 287.54 50.70% | 346.91 20.65% | 351.97 1.46% | 377.37 7.22% | 488.82 29.53% | |
capex per share | -2.20 - | -3.30 50.14% | -4.41 33.82% | -7.04 59.52% | -11.69 66.04% | -19.24 64.65% | -17.28 10.22% | -15.98 7.50% | -19.79 23.83% | -13.10 33.80% | ||
capex to depreciation | -2.89 - | -1.75 39.56% | -1.62 7.26% | -1.23 24.14% | -1.35 10.37% | -1.34 1.19% | -1.07 20.10% | -0.90 15.74% | -1.11 23.08% | -0.73 34.03% | ||
capex to operating cash flow | -0.18 - | -0.19 3.25% | -0.19 2.07% | -0.22 14.48% | -0.24 9.12% | -0.33 37.95% | -0.25 23.58% | -0.19 25.86% | -0.37 100.48% | -0.17 53.96% | ||
capex to revenue | -0.09 - | -0.10 11.15% | -0.11 6.05% | -0.11 3.39% | -0.12 7.54% | -0.13 10.50% | -0.09 32.41% | -0.06 32.39% | -0.06 3.83% | -0.04 36.74% | ||
cash per share | 20.72 - | 53.91 160.16% | 47.07 12.70% | 60.49 28.51% | 82.33 36.11% | 78.75 4.36% | 138.26 75.57% | 178.90 29.40% | 168.88 5.60% | 199.99 18.42% | 301.92 50.97% | |
days of inventory on hand | 172.44 - | 35.18 79.60% | -166.61 573.64% | 44.95 126.98% | 15.46 65.60% | 15.05 2.65% | 19.21 27.60% | 24.14 25.68% | 20.36 15.67% | 18.96 6.89% | ||
days payables outstanding | 55.86 - | 303.74 443.76% | 290.41 4.39% | 123.74 57.39% | 276.76 123.67% | 207.63 24.98% | 208.81 0.57% | 226.11 8.29% | 183.67 18.77% | 183.23 0.24% | 178.85 2.39% | |
days sales outstanding | 110.81 - | 4.00 96.39% | 61.45 1,436.45% | 51.11 16.83% | 63.05 23.36% | 56.75 9.99% | 60.32 6.29% | 63.46 5.21% | 62.47 1.56% | 33.04 47.10% | ||
debt to assets | 0.37 - | 0.21 44.08% | 0.16 23.01% | 0.18 14.18% | 0.18 3.27% | 0.14 20.52% | 0.10 31.35% | 0.09 7.63% | 0.08 5.53% | 0.09 10.41% | 0.10 5.13% | |
debt to equity | 1.04 - | 0.36 65.12% | 0.27 26.37% | 0.33 23.58% | 0.34 4.31% | 0.27 20.51% | 0.17 39.14% | 0.16 4.18% | 0.15 6.34% | 0.16 9.41% | 0.17 6.17% | |
dividend yield | 0.00 - | 0.00 47.45% | 0.02 26,585.85% | 0.05 126.72% | 0.00 - | 0.01 - | 0.01 - | |||||
earnings yield | 0.02 - | 0.02 9.37% | 0.06 182.15% | 0.02 58.47% | 0.02 4.67% | 0.03 24.68% | 0.04 46.92% | 0.04 9.09% | 0.03 10.86% | 0.04 18.46% | 0.07 88.41% | |
enterprise value | 1.27T - | 1.15T 9.82% | 1.21T 5.18% | 1.80T 48.84% | 2.78T 54.29% | 3.08T 10.90% | 3.42T 11.16% | 3.85T 12.46% | 1.82T 52.81% | 1.81T 0.41% | 954.94B 47.22% | |
enterprise value over ebitda | 41.53 - | 30.79 25.86% | 13.93 54.75% | 24.02 72.43% | 24.89 3.61% | 27.46 10.35% | 18.43 32.90% | 21.10 14.49% | 15.53 26.37% | 14.78 4.84% | 5.55 62.47% | |
ev to operating cash flow | 48.33 - | 27.89 42.28% | 21.28 23.73% | 22.41 5.32% | 22.19 0.99% | 20.40 8.06% | 18.96 7.08% | 16.61 12.38% | 12.73 23.39% | 9.06 28.82% | 5.23 42.26% | |
ev to sales | 24.28 - | 15.09 37.86% | 11.96 20.76% | 11.37 4.88% | 11.10 2.42% | 8.17 26.35% | 6.72 17.81% | 5.37 20.09% | 2.13 60.32% | 2.08 2.20% | 1.01 51.29% | |
free cash flow per share | 9.93 - | 14.34 44.37% | 18.71 30.48% | 25.18 34.59% | 37.34 48.28% | 39.28 5.18% | 51.47 31.05% | 69.79 35.59% | 33.19 52.45% | 63.07 90.03% | 90.47 43.45% | |
free cash flow yield | 0.02 - | 0.03 63.04% | 0.04 31.46% | 0.03 7.25% | 0.03 1.36% | 0.03 3.36% | 0.04 15.31% | 0.05 25.83% | 0.05 2.25% | 0.09 87.37% | 0.17 89.84% | |
graham net net | -4.90 - | 12.73 359.73% | 2.47 80.62% | -4.66 288.67% | -12.84 175.86% | -38.10 196.69% | 0.18 100.48% | -5.80 3,260.69% | -12.52 115.77% | -12.35 1.32% | -21.26 72.08% | |
graham number | 66.29 - | 120.57 81.89% | 240.30 99.31% | 209.96 12.63% | 284.49 35.50% | 382.41 34.42% | 606.63 58.63% | 659.49 8.71% | 427.71 35.14% | 485.44 13.50% | 659.21 35.80% | |
income quality | 1.13 - | 1.69 50.36% | 0.80 52.96% | 1.95 144.39% | 2.04 4.61% | 1.88 7.68% | 1.29 31.61% | 1.62 25.71% | 3.03 87.45% | 2.74 9.49% | 2.29 16.57% | |
intangibles to total assets | 0.14 - | 0.20 46.75% | 0.25 22.07% | 0.29 16.68% | 0.28 3.58% | 0.35 24.43% | 0.26 25.50% | 0.22 16.37% | 0.19 9.85% | 0.18 7.34% | 0.15 18.11% | |
interest coverage | 11.35 - | 8.41 25.90% | 14.95 77.76% | 17.99 20.31% | 19.44 8.04% | 11.00 43.41% | 33.28 202.60% | 37.99 14.15% | 5.11 86.55% | 5.91 15.62% | 15.59 163.88% | |
interest debt per share | 19.89 - | 23.68 19.04% | 24.29 2.59% | 37.87 55.86% | 50.57 33.55% | 54.07 6.91% | 49.72 8.05% | 56.85 14.35% | 60.10 5.72% | 68.00 13.15% | 88.56 30.22% | |
inventory turnover | 2.12 - | 10.38 390.21% | -2.19 121.11% | 8.12 470.63% | 23.60 190.71% | 24.25 2.73% | 19.00 21.63% | 15.12 20.44% | 17.93 18.58% | 19.26 7.40% | ||
invested capital | 1.04 - | 0.36 65.12% | 0.27 26.37% | 0.33 23.58% | 0.34 4.31% | 0.27 20.51% | 0.17 39.14% | 0.16 4.18% | 0.15 6.34% | 0.16 9.41% | 0.17 6.17% | |
market cap | 1.27T - | 1.21T 4.85% | 1.26T 4.39% | 1.85T 47.18% | 2.85T 53.94% | 3.14T 9.98% | 3.63T 15.73% | 4.02T 10.84% | 1.87T 53.62% | 1.84T 1.30% | 1.07T 41.85% | |
net current asset value | -3.02B - | 44.09B 1,562.29% | 19.51B 55.75% | -827M 104.24% | -20.83B 2,418.74% | -79.40B 281.19% | 29.59B 137.27% | 36.78B 24.29% | 25.18B 31.55% | 67.84B 169.49% | 100.63B 48.33% | |
net debt to ebitda | 0.26 - | -1.49 669.18% | -0.57 62.05% | -0.69 22.83% | -0.66 4.76% | -0.50 24.89% | -1.10 122.32% | -0.94 14.55% | -0.42 55.98% | -0.26 37.55% | -0.67 159.18% | |
net income per share | 10.72 - | 10.38 3.16% | 29.07 180.05% | 17.52 39.74% | 25.10 43.29% | 34.06 35.69% | 56.88 66.98% | 55.72 2.04% | 23.10 58.54% | 27.75 20.14% | 39.51 42.36% | |
operating cash flow per share | 12.13 - | 17.64 45.42% | 23.12 31.11% | 32.22 39.35% | 49.03 52.16% | 58.52 19.36% | 68.75 17.48% | 85.77 24.76% | 52.98 38.23% | 76.17 43.78% | 90.47 18.78% | |
payables turnover | 6.53 - | 1.20 81.61% | 1.26 4.59% | 2.95 134.70% | 1.32 55.29% | 1.76 33.29% | 1.75 0.56% | 1.61 7.65% | 1.99 23.10% | 1.99 0.24% | 2.04 2.45% | |
receivables turnover | 3.29 - | 91.26 2,670.69% | 5.94 93.49% | 7.14 20.23% | 5.79 18.93% | 6.43 11.10% | 6.05 5.91% | 5.75 4.95% | 5.84 1.59% | 11.05 89.04% | ||
research and ddevelopement to revenue | 0.10 - | 0.14 44.18% | 0.14 2.53% | 0.11 20.93% | 0.09 15.65% | 0.10 9.26% | 0.08 14.92% | 0.08 5.59% | 0.07 18.52% | 0.07 0.47% | 0.06 15.00% | |
return on tangible assets | 0.24 - | 0.12 50.89% | 0.26 118.66% | 0.12 53.51% | 0.12 2.23% | 0.14 12.44% | 0.15 10.16% | 0.11 25.92% | 0.05 59.87% | 0.05 11.13% | 0.05 4.67% | |
revenue per share | 24.14 - | 32.61 35.08% | 41.15 26.19% | 63.49 54.29% | 98.02 54.40% | 146.06 49.01% | 194.02 32.83% | 265.43 36.81% | 316.56 19.27% | 331.24 4.64% | 466.34 40.78% | |
roe | 0.59 - | 0.17 71.65% | 0.33 97.42% | 0.16 52.43% | 0.18 11.84% | 0.18 1.90% | 0.20 10.80% | 0.16 18.80% | 0.07 59.14% | 0.07 12.06% | 0.08 9.91% | |
roic | 0.27 - | 0.09 65.57% | 0.09 1.38% | 0.10 5.26% | 0.12 15.57% | 0.08 34.68% | 0.17 121.94% | 0.13 25.27% | 0.05 58.88% | 0.07 35.87% | 0.08 19.16% | |
sales general and administrative to revenue | 0.08 - | 0.10 27.41% | 0.09 11.09% | 0.08 15.03% | 0.06 16.08% | 0.07 1.77% | 0.06 16.24% | 0.08 39.17% | 0.04 51.40% | 0.05 29.77% | ||
shareholders equity per share | 18.22 - | 62.23 241.62% | 88.28 41.85% | 111.83 26.68% | 143.28 28.12% | 190.80 33.16% | 287.54 50.70% | 346.91 20.65% | 351.97 1.46% | 377.37 7.22% | 488.82 29.53% | |
stock based compensation to revenue | 0.05 - | 0.17 215.62% | 0.16 7.00% | 0.10 36.44% | 0.08 20.63% | 0.10 24.03% | 0.06 37.40% | 0.07 12.20% | 0.03 59.78% | 0.04 26.30% | ||
tangible asset value | 25.34B - | 105.80B 317.49% | 160.00B 51.23% | 178.26B 11.42% | 240.45B 34.88% | 282.19B 17.36% | 541.92B 92.04% | 720.03B 32.87% | 753.38B 4.63% | 807.92B 7.24% | 852.92B 5.57% | |
tangible book value per share | 11.65 - | 45.27 288.55% | 65.09 43.78% | 71.51 9.85% | 94.18 31.71% | 109.38 16.14% | 206.28 88.60% | 266.44 29.17% | 279.57 4.93% | 308.07 10.19% | 422.61 37.18% | |
working capital | 30.45B - | 102.44B 236.42% | 82.03B 19.92% | 88.30B 7.64% | 121.05B 37.08% | 62.60B 48.28% | 221.05B 253.09% | 266.00B 20.34% | 254.75B 4.23% | 312.62B 22.71% | 331.36B 6.00% |
All numbers in USD (except ratios and percentages)